Qualifications
Gas Safe Register is required by law when someone is installing, repairing or maintaining the gas appliance in your home. If they're not, they could be working in violation of the law and putting you at risk of gas leaks explosions, fires or carbon monoxide poisoning.
Check an engineer's registration by examining their Gas Safe copyright. This card should have a unique licence and a date of issue. The date of issue tells you if the engineer has the qualifications for the job or if he requires additional education or experience.
You'll need to find an engineer in heating who is qualified for the job. For instance, if having a new boiler installed it is recommended to make sure that the engineer is Gas Safe registered for central heating installation. It is also possible to inquire about their other qualifications in the industry - the Chartered Institute of Plumbing and Heating Engineering (CIPHE) offers ways to become an experienced heating engineer or plumber, as does the Engineering Council and the Association of Plumbing and Heating Contractors (APHC).

Check the copyright of the person you are checking with.
Gas fittings are available only to registered Gas Safe tradespeople. Gas fittings should only be worked on by Gas Safe registered professionals. It is essential to employ an experienced engineer for any maintenance or repair work.
All gas engineers should be wearing an Gas Safe copyright which they are expected to show you. The copyright should include a photograph (make sure it's a picture of the engineer's face), the company they work for as well as their registration date and expiration date, and their license number. The back of the card must include the jobs they're certified to do and the appliances they are able to safely work on.
Gas Safe registration is required for anyone working on heating appliances like cookers and boilers. If they are not registered, they could be working illegally placing you and your family at risk of gas explosions, fires or carbon monoxide poisoning.

While the typical hourly rate for a certified gas engineer is PS40 to PS70, rates can vary according to the nature of the task and the time required to complete it. For instance, emergency or after-hours services might cost more than normal rates, and some engineers also charge for materials and travel.
It's illegal to perform gas work without having a Gas Safe registration. Ask your engineer click here for the number and then verify it online. You'll have peace of mind knowing that the work is being carried out legally and safely. The best way to make sure that your boiler is functioning properly and safely is to book an annual service with a Gas Safe registered engineer. This will not only aid in keeping your home warmer and more energy efficient It will also help to identify any minor issues before they develop into costly repairs in the future. Plus, many boiler manufacturers require a service to confirm the warranty on your appliance.
